Handover Note — JV Proposal with Marrowfield Group

Tomas, here's where things stand as I rotate off. The joint venture with Marrowfield to co-develop the Lanterbay logistics hub is at term-sheet stage. Their side is keen but wants a decision before their fiscal close. Our counsel flagged two governance points; notes are in the shared folder. The board will want your read at the next session. The confidential outline of our intentions is set out directly below.

board note of bawep-tajef: Queniusek Systems plans to raise the Quenvan list price by 53.1 percent in March. The pricing group signed off on a budget of $176.4 million for Project Drueth. The renewal with Casionix Partners closes at $142.5 million a year, 8.3 percent below the last contract. Project Fraax slips by six weeks because of the tooling delay.

# Pagination Limits — Quartzline Public API

On-call reference. Cursor-based pagination only; offset params were removed in v4. Clients exceeding page-size caps get a 422, not a truncated page. Cursors expire; expired cursors return 410 and clients must restart. Rate limits apply per token, counted per page fetched, not per logical query. Abuse pattern to watch: parallel cursor walks from one token. The enforced constants are as follows.

constants for bawif-kawif:
QUOTAS = {
    "ulaael": 5,
    "holael": 10,
}

// Pricing experiment constants — project Miravel (discussed at eng sync).
// The bandit adjusts ticket prices inside hard guardrails: clamped
// per-ticket and per-order, with a daily exposure cap so no event gets
// more than a fixed share of experimental traffic. Changing any value
// resets the experiment's stats, so bundle changes and announce at sync
// before merging. Rollback is config-only; the worker picks it up on
// the next tick. Current guardrails and caps are defined below.

tuning table, yajog-yahof:
BUDGETS = {
    "lamvan": 303,
    "wenox": 460,
    "fenvan": 525,
}

## Changelog — Farepilot pricing experiment

Changed defaults for the Tierhop ticket-pricing experiment. Surge multiplier cap lowered, holdout cohort widened, and price refresh moved from hourly to per-session. Rollback path unchanged; flag flip reverts within one cycle. No action needed from adjacent teams. For the eng sync record, the new default configuration is listed below.

config for kagup-hahig:
druwyn:
  pin: 2801
  metrics_host: metrics.druwyn.zemvarlabs.internal
  tenant: sorius
  seal: seal_798a43d7